    I've got to sing the praises of USAA's credit card here. It is by far the best card I have. I've had it for 4 years and they have NEVER jerked me around-like MBNA or DISCOVER giving a 12.99 fixed rate..err 14.99. In fact my interest rate has only gone down and my credit line up! I have good credit and I just switched to a better plan they have where the current interest rate is 5.75(prime +1%) and a i think a $50 fee waived the first year, otherwise their interest varies up to I believe 18% variable. No fees for cash advances, checks, or balance transfers and the interest rate is whatever your purchase apr is. Talk to their customer service reps and ask them what they think about the company and you will get glowing reviews!
    They have an internally generated score for determining credit line increase, which is great for keeping hard inquiries off. What you do is ask for a CL increase and if they can't give right away, that means your score isn't high enough, so say nevermind(you might even just ask upfront if your score is high enough for an increase).
    Incidently, you no longer have to be in the military to get the card. You do however have to get a USAA member # which takes a few minutes.
